About the Role

Performs general administrative support tasks within Engineering, Finance and Customer Service. Prepares documents, spreadsheets, reports and presentations. Creates and/or maintains appropriate logs, databases, inventories, filing (hard or soft copy), status reports/tracking. May perform some research or data analysis tasks. Manages correspondence and multiple calendars. Will schedule and coordinate meetings, business travel and other events.

Primary Responsibilities
  • Anticipate and highlight key points for action for the Head of Wescam Engineering, Finance and Customer Service and other members of the Leadership Team.
  • Support cross functional activities with individuals at all levels in a fast-paced environment
  • Help manage departmental communications to internal and external key stakeholders
  • Prioritize conflicting needs; handles matters efficiently, proactively, and follows-through on projects to successful completion
  • Manage travel arrangements and expense reporting
  • Actively monitor key deadlines and tracking tasks including coordination and tracking of yearly strategic goals.
  • Coordinate meetings and assist in the coordination, planning and execution of engagement events
  • Simple budgeting and associated reporting responsibilities, including credit card reconciliation and financial management support
  • Provide administrative support to the broader senior leadership team as required, including event management and administrative duties
  • Manage and maintain the complex calendars and schedules of Directors and direct reports, resolve conflicting priorities and arrange changes as required, that may include coordination, verification, and scheduling of meetings
  • Coordination of Visitor Requests requiring Security & Trade compliance, and manage all associated meeting logistics including room reservations, audiovisual needs, catering etc.
  • Prepare required reports and presentations to ensure required material / content is ready for primary review prior to scheduled meetings
  • Assist in the coordination, planning and execution of business critical events such as audits and customer visits
  • Raising and processing internal purchase requisitions & purchase orders
  • Reconcile event budgets and invoicing as required
  • Assist with the production & management of special projects as required
  • General office administration duties
  • Suggest process improvement initiatives.
  • Occasional travel to Don Mills location may be required

L3Harris performs background checks prior to employment as all applicants must be eligible for registration with the Controlled Goods Program and obtain and maintain a positive security assessment. Some positions may require a government of Canada “Reliability” status and/or Level 2 (Secret) security clearance. In addition, L3Harris performs pre-employment substance abuse testing where required.
